📖 What Does B0961 Mean?
Symptoms
- • Inconsistent temperature
- • poor air flow
- • fan not working
- • or unusual noises from the climate control system.
Common Causes
- • Faulty temperature sensor
- • clogged air ducts
- • malfunctioning fan motor
- • or faulty climate control module.
Possible Solutions
1. Check and clean the air ducts for blockages. 2. Inspect and replace the temperature sensor if faulty. 3. Test the fan motor and replace if necessary. 4. Update or replace the climate control module if faulty.
